Leatherneck Soccer Falls at SIU-E

EDWARDSVILLE – The Western Illinois University men's soccer went on the road Saturday and dropped a pivotal Ohio Valley Conference match to league-leading Southern Illinois-Edwardsville, 3-0.

The Cougars (8-4-3 overall, 6-1-1 in OVC) had a quick start to the match, scoring in the ninth minute.

Western Illinois (7-9-1 overall, 2-6 in OVC) was able to hold SIU-E down for 10 minutes, but the Cougars notched their second goal at the 19:05 mark. SIU-E added their third goal of the half two minutes later, taking a 3-0 lead into the break.

Western Illinois finished with six shots, one on goal. Keeper Micah Ramirez finished with three saves and six shots on the net.

The Leathernecks hold a tenuous grip on sixth place and the final spot in the conference tournament as Southern Indiana drew with Eastern Illinois, 2-2- on Saturday. Western Illinois has six points in league play while the Screaming Eagles have five and Panthers have four.

Western Illinois is next in action on Thursday, hosting Incarnate Word at 3 p.m.
